Job Summary
We are currently looking for an individual to contribute their first-rate skills as Quality Engineer, a newly created role within our Quality Department. The candidate in this position will need to possess Quality Control techniques to improve manufacturing process reliability, remedy non-conforming product issues, address customer needs, and ensure compliance with all company and industry standards. Duties will include supporting the Department’s role in new products and material evaluations. The person in this role will play a substantial role in the continuous development and improvement of Tectran’s Quality Management System.
Responsibilities:
Assist in supervising compliance to all standards and specifications including ISO-9001, DOT, FMVSS and SAE standards as well as product regulatory requirements to Calif Prop 65, Reach, GADSL, RoHS, TSCA, and Conflict Minerals Reporting
Create, revise, distribute, and file manufacturing instructions, standard procedures, process specifications, forms, and visual standards. Ensure the latest revision is controlled and used
Manage the non-conforming process. Facilitate non-conforming material (NCMR) disposition. Contain stock; coordinate rework activity (includes training, quality alerts and visual aids). Verify conformance to customer requirements. Support Material Review Board (MRB)
Manage the corrective action process. Facilitate correction action procedure (CAR). Write C.A.R.; support interim action, root cause, corrective action, preventative action, and implementation. Perform verification
Determine and develop new inspection/verification methods and tooling as needed to support new and existing product requirements. Provide training as necessary
Manage the Quality System Audit process. Perform process and Quality System audits
Perform quality inspections and testing as needed
Participate in improving our product, processes, equipment, and methods. Solicit product and process improvement ideas and report to supervision and management
Write Technical Product Specifications and Data charts as needed for use in marketing and customer communications and/or Tectran web site
Support and perform customer specific requirements including first article inspection, creating PPAP documentation and performing prototype testing
Perform inspection and testing (failure analysis) on product returns to determine root cause of problem and generate reports to management
Communicate with our domestic and foreign suppliers regarding new product evaluations and existing product quality concerns
Update periodic quality graphs and performance indicator reports including scrap counts, non-conforming material analysis and customer complaint log
